Description

Season five kicks off with the announcement nobody asked for but everyone needed: We're Not Marketers is throwing an event, and it's nothing like the stale hotel ballroom marathons you're used to. 

Eric, Zach, and Gab break down why they're risking it all to create a three-day PMM experience that's equal parts tactical workshop, adventure vacation, and therapy session for product marketers who are tired of pretending B2B has to be boring. 

Get the juicy details on how they infiltrated Drive 2025, why they're limiting attendance to 150 people, and what happens when three solopreneurs decide confidence beats certainty. 


→ Why three solopreneurs with zero event planning experience think they can beat PMA
→ The real reason behind the fake mustaches at Drive (hint: it's not just for laughs)

→ The "sitting makes you stupid" theory: Why ballroom marathons kill creativity

→ How wearing a Halloween costume to a B2B event makes you more yourself, not less

→ Most PMMs need a recharge and haven't had one in years


If you've ever wondered why PMM events feel like eating cardboard while someone reads you PowerPoint slides, this episode will either inspire you or make you think we've completely lost it.
